Abstract (en)
[origin: WO03095228A1] The invention relates to an optically variable element, in particular an optically variable security element for safeguarding banknotes, credit cards or similar, in addition to a security product and a foil, in particular a stamped foil or a laminated foil comprising an optically variable element of this type. The optically variable element has a thin-film layer (54, 55, 58) for creating colour shifts by means of interference and an additional layer (51, 52, 53, 59). The thin-film is configured as a partial thin-film element, which covers only certain regions of the surface area of the additional layer, forming a pattern.
